About 90 minutes from Berkeley is a magical redwood forest with a real steam train chugging up and down steep passes. If you’ve never made the trip to Roaring Camp Railroad, you’re missing something special.
What to expect at Roaring Camp Railroad
There are a couple of different options: you can drive to the camp in Felton, which is located inside the beautiful redwoods, and take a real steam train on a loop through the forest. Or, you can get a diesel train with open cars that leaves from the Santa Cruz beach boardwalk, drives through town, and heads up and back into the redwoods.

Plan your visit to Roaring Camp Railroad
- See schedules and information at www.roaringcamp.com.
- Book your tickets in advance and plan to arrive about 30 minutes before your scheduled departure. There are many photo props and a play area that are usually open. There is a meager snack bar as well.
- Pricing is $25 – $45
Other excuses to visit Roaring Camp near Santa Cruz
Throughout the year, Roaring Camp Railroads has many special events on Mother’s Day and Father’s Day, as well as the always popular Thomas and Percy’s Halloween Party. So if you have a small person in your house who can’t get enough of Thomas, Chuggington, and every other chugging choo choo out there, you might even want to spend a whole train-themed weekend in Santa Cruz.
